Key Insights

The global automotive parts import and export logistics market is projected for substantial expansion, driven by increased automotive industry globalization and rising worldwide vehicle demand. The market is valued at $249.2 billion in the base year 2025 and is expected to grow at a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 8.1% from 2025 to 2033, reaching an estimated value by 2033. Key growth drivers include the necessity for efficient, just-in-time (JIT) manufacturing logistics to minimize inventory and production delays, the adaptable logistics networks required for expanding e-commerce and direct-to-consumer sales, and the intricate nature of international supply chains demanding specialized expertise in cross-border transportation and customs clearance. The market is segmented by transport mode (road, rail, waterway, others) and application (automotive manufacturers, auto parts suppliers), with road transport currently leading due to its extensive reach and flexibility. Leading players are implementing advanced technologies like blockchain and AI to boost supply chain visibility, optimize routes, and enhance operational efficiency. Nevertheless, geopolitical instability, trade disputes, and volatile fuel prices present potential market growth challenges.

Regional market dynamics for automotive parts import and export logistics align with global automotive manufacturing and consumption patterns. North America and Asia Pacific currently dominate, owing to significant automotive production centers in the United States, China, and Japan. However, emerging economies in South America, Africa, and Southeast Asia exhibit significant growth potential as automotive manufacturing expands into these areas. The market is characterized by intense competition, with established logistics providers facing competition from specialized niche players. Future growth will be shaped by the adoption of electric vehicles (EVs) and autonomous driving technologies, potentially altering supply chain structures and logistical needs. Additionally, growing sustainability concerns are propelling demand for eco-friendly transportation solutions, encouraging investment in alternative fuels and optimized delivery routes.

Driving Forces: What's Propelling the Auto Parts Import and Export Logistics Market?

Several key factors are accelerating growth within the auto parts import and export logistics sector. The ever-increasing globalization of the automotive industry necessitates seamless cross-border transportation of components. The shift towards electric vehicles (EVs) and advanced driver-assistance systems (ADAS) is creating demand for specialized logistics solutions capable of handling delicate and high-tech parts. Furthermore, the rise of e-commerce and direct-to-consumer sales channels is transforming the landscape, requiring agile and responsive logistics networks. The increasing focus on reducing lead times and optimizing inventory management is another significant driver. Companies are adopting just-in-time (JIT) strategies, demanding efficient and reliable logistics providers to ensure a consistent supply of parts. Finally, technological advancements, such as the Internet of Things (IoT), artificial intelligence (AI), and blockchain technology, are enhancing supply chain visibility, tracking, and efficiency, thereby further propelling market growth. These advancements enable real-time monitoring, predictive analytics, and improved risk management, leading to cost savings and improved operational efficiency.

Challenges and Restraints in Auto Parts Import and Export Logistics

Despite the strong growth prospects, the auto parts import and export logistics market faces significant challenges. Geopolitical instability and trade wars can disrupt supply chains, leading to delays and increased costs. Fluctuations in fuel prices and currency exchange rates add to the unpredictability of operating costs. The complexity of regulations and compliance requirements across different countries can create hurdles for logistics providers. Moreover, ensuring the security and integrity of shipments, especially high-value parts, remains a constant concern. The increasing demand for sustainable logistics solutions necessitates investments in eco-friendly transportation modes and infrastructure. This presents both an opportunity and a challenge for logistics providers. Finally, the ongoing shortage of skilled labor in the logistics industry can impede efficient operations. Addressing these challenges requires collaboration among stakeholders, including manufacturers, logistics providers, and governments, to foster a more resilient and sustainable auto parts logistics ecosystem.

Key Region or Country & Segment to Dominate the Market

The Asia-Pacific region, particularly China, is expected to dominate the auto parts import and export logistics market due to its massive automotive manufacturing base and rapidly expanding automotive industry. North America and Europe also represent significant markets.

  • Dominant Segment (Application): Automotive Manufacturers account for a significant portion of the market due to their high volume requirements and need for reliable, just-in-time deliveries.

  • Dominant Segment (Type): Road transport currently holds the largest share of the market due to its flexibility and accessibility. However, rail transport is gaining traction for longer distances due to its cost-effectiveness and reduced carbon footprint.

  • Growth in other segments: Waterway transport is experiencing growth for bulk shipments, particularly across international routes. "Others," which includes air freight and specialized handling, are seeing increased adoption for time-sensitive and high-value components.

Regional Breakdown:

  • Asia-Pacific: The region's dominance stems from rapid industrialization and a substantial manufacturing base, particularly in China, Japan, South Korea, and India. The increasing production of vehicles and auto parts within the region fuels the demand for sophisticated logistics solutions.

  • North America: This region benefits from a robust automotive sector and strong ties with global supply chains. The presence of major automotive manufacturers and well-established logistics infrastructure contributes significantly to market growth.

  • Europe: While mature, the European market continues to witness growth driven by advancements in automotive technology and the increasing demand for EVs. The region’s focus on efficient and sustainable logistics solutions further supports market expansion.

The automotive manufacturers segment's dominance is predicated on their high-volume needs, complex global supply chains, and stringent quality control measures. They require reliable and efficient logistics solutions to meet production schedules and maintain the quality of their products. Similarly, road transport's dominance reflects its flexibility and its ability to reach a wide range of locations, vital for just-in-time delivery of automotive parts.
